"Post COVID care and rehab"

About: Daisy Hill Hospital / Female Medical

(as a relative),

My dad was cared for on Female Medical recently after recovering from COVID.  He asked us to pass on his thanks to all the staff who cared for him.  He felt in good hands and while everyone was busy they were attentive, efficient and proficient but also friendly and caring.  

We also want to pass our thanks as his family, while it was unfortunate that the ward is closed to visitors just as he came onto it, we were reassured by being able to speak to the nursing staff about how he was doing and knowing he was being looked after.  

Dad and us are just so grateful to have him back home and we can't thank the staff enough for helping to get him here.  You are doing an amazing job and we are so pleased he was under your care.
